Programme reduces design times of assembly components by 40%

A programme, which is claimed to reduce the design times of micro-mechanical assembly components by 40% or more, has been introduced by STANLEY Engineered Fastening. The Electronics Engineered Standards Program is designed for electronics design and manufacturing companies seeking to accelerate their innovation cycles, lower total costs and increase first-time yields.

Improve resistance to vibrational loosening, shock & heat

Offering enhanced electronics performance with improved fastener resistance to vibrational loosening, drop shock and high heat, the self-locking Spiralock micro threaded inserts have been introduced by STANLEY Engineered Fastening. The internal thread form design securely and cost-effectively attaches components in compact electronic assemblies.
